Iran has suspended indirect talks with the United States through mediators in response to Israel's expanded military operations in Lebanon and Gaza. Tehran demands a halt to Israeli strikes and withdrawal from occupied areas before resuming negotiations. Iran and its regional allies, including the Resistance Front, have threatened to block key maritime routes such as the Strait of Hormuz and Bab El Mandeb Strait to pressure Israel and its supporters. Iranian officials emphasize that violations on any front breach the ceasefire across all fronts, holding the US and Israel responsible for consequences.
